Real‑World Experience: How Do People Use Batanaful?
On the Batanaful site, the “Real Results” and customer feedback sections offer a good window into how people actually use these oils day to day.
Most users apply Pure Batana Oil or Wonder Oil in one of three ways:
- As a pre‑shampoo treatment, massaging it into the scalp and lengths for 20–60 minutes before washing.
- As a leave‑in treatment on damp hair, focusing on mid‑lengths and ends to reduce frizz and add shine.
- As a targeted repair oil on very dry areas, such as edges, ends, or specific patches of breakage.
Reviews frequently mention:
- Hair feels softer and more manageable after a few uses.
- Reduced breakage and fewer split ends, especially for curly, coily or chemically treated hair.
- Some users also apply a small amount on dry patches of skin or stretch marks, describing the oil as soothing and deeply moisturizing.
Of course, results vary — no oil can magically reverse years of damage overnight. But the general pattern is that consistency pays off: people who use the oil regularly over several weeks report the most noticeable improvements.

What to Consider Before You Buy
Even with all the positives, Batanaful may not be for everyone.
- It’s still an oil: If your hair is very fine, extremely oily, or you dislike the feel of any oil, you might need to experiment with very small amounts or use it strictly as a pre‑wash treatment.
- Consistency is key: Batana oil is more of a long‑term repair and nourishment strategy than a quick styling fix. If you’re not ready to commit to regular use, you might not see its full benefits.
- Not a medical treatment: While users report softer hair, less breakage and happier scalps, Batanaful is not a medical product. It’s not a cure for hair loss or skin conditions, and shouldn’t replace medical advice.
